Thank you, James. In May of last year, we described our multiyear journey to deliver double-digit revenue growth, operating leverage, and disciplined capital management. And I'm pleased to report strong execution and solid results across all three fronts in the quarter. But before I go into my prepared remarks, I'd like to address an important topic.
On January 6, we became aware of unauthorized access to a limited part of the NextGen network. Upon investigation, we learned the company was the target of a sophisticated cyber-attack. We immediately executed our internal response procedures and contained the threat, secured our network, and have returned to normal operations.
Our forensic review is ongoing and to date we have not uncovered any evidence of access to or ex-filtration of client or patient data. Based on our investigation to date, this incident impacted select administrative non-client files within our network. In total, this affected less than 1% of the devices used by our employees. Out of an abundance of caution as soon as we noticed the threat, we severed connectivity to some systems and notified clients who were impacted in a timely manner.
